Form 4: Meta Director Tony Xu Acquires Shares
Insider Transaction Report
Meta Platforms Director Tony Xu acquired 189 Class A Common Stock shares through the settlement of Restricted Stock Units.
Summary
- Tony Xu, a Director at Meta Platforms, Inc., acquired 189 shares of Class A Common Stock.
- The acquisition occurred on August 15, 2025, through the settlement of Restricted Stock Units (RSUs).
- Each RSU represents a contingent right to receive one share of Class A Common Stock.
- Following this transaction, Tony Xu directly beneficially owns 7,291 shares of Class A Common Stock.
- He also continues to hold 378 unvested Restricted Stock Units.
- The RSUs vest quarterly as to 1/16th of the total, with vesting beginning on May 15, 2022, contingent on continued service.
